132MHz-142MHz bandpass filter with a center frequency of 137MHz

 
Overview
A bandpass filter is a filter that allows frequency components within a specific frequency range to pass through, but attenuates frequency components in other ranges to extremely low levels, as opposed to a bandstop filter. An example of an analog bandpass filter is a resistor-inductor-capacitor (RLC) circuit. These filters can also be generated by combining low-pass and high-pass filters.
★ Simulation of the filter using simulation software:
Simulation results are:
loss = 0.2dB, center = 134.8MHz, bandwidth = 10MHz,
meeting expectations.
